Choosing the Right Air Tight Recessed Light for Your Needs

With so many options available, selecting the right air tight recessed light can feel overwhelming. Let's break down some key considerations:

  • Size: Common sizes include 3 inch, 4 inch, and 6 inch. Choose the size that best fits your existing openings or desired aesthetic.
  • Trim Style: Options include white trim, black trim, brushed nickel, oil rubbed bronze, and bronze. Select a finish that complements your décor. Baffle trim and reflector trim are also available, each offering a different light distribution pattern. Square and round options are also available for different design aesthetics.
  • Light Source: LED air tight recessed lights are the most energy-efficient option, offering long lifespans and excellent light quality. Many are dimmable, allowing you to adjust the brightness to your liking.
  • Installation Type: Choose between remodel and new construction options, depending on your project.
  • Special Features: Consider features like IC rating (suitable for direct contact with insulation), Energy Star certification, adjustable gimbal, and integrated junction box.
  • Color Temperature: Warm white, daylight, and adjustable color temperature options are available to create the perfect ambiance in each room.

For damp locations like the shower or outdoor areas, ensure the fixture is rated for wet locations. Consider air tight recessed lighting kits for a complete and easy installation. For rooms with limited space above the ceiling, slim or shallow fixtures are an excellent choice. Many include integrated LED, simplifying the installation process.
